People v. Clayton
Michigan Supreme Court
People v. Clayton, 740 N.W.2d 279 (Mich. 2007)
480 Mich. 922
People v. Clayton
Opinion
PEOPLE of the State of Michigan, Plaintiff-Appellee,
v.
Julius Leonard CLAYTON, Defendant-Appellant.
Supreme Court of Michigan.
On order of the Court, the application for leave to appeal the May 14, 2007 order of the Court of Appeals is considered, and it is DENIED, because the defendant has failed to meet the burden of establishing entitlement to relief under MCR 6.508(D).
